HomeMy WebLinkAboutResolution No. 2018-37Sponsored by: Administration CITY OF KENAI RESOLUTION NO. 2018-37 A RESOLUTION OF THE CO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F KENAI , ALASKA, AWARDING AN AGREEMENT TO CROWLEY FUELS , LLC . FOR THE FUEL FURNISH & DELIVERY 2018 INVITATION TO BID. WHEREAS , the Public Works Department released an Invitation to Bid on May 29, 2018 with Bids Due on June 12, 2018; the following Bids were received: Bidder Price per gallon Crowley Fuels LLC $2.705 Alaska Oil Sales Inc $3.084 and, WHEREAS, Crowley Fuels, LLC was found to be the lowest responsive and responsible bidder and award to this bidder will be in the best interest of the City; and, WHEREAS , the recommendation from the City Administration is to award the agreement to Crowley Fuels, LLC for furnishing and delivering diesel fuel; and, WHEREAS, the Bidder's invoiced price per gallon for Diesel Fuel will adjust based on the Oil Price Information Services (OPIS) Reports; and WHEREAS, the term of the agreement will be from July 1, 2018 to June 30, 2021 . The agreement term may be extended upon mutual agreement of the parties for two additional one year periods. The agreement will not be extended beyond June 30, 2023; and, WHEREAS, sufficient monies are appropriated. N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ED BY THE CO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F KENAI , ALASKA, Section 1. That the City Manager is authorized to execute a contract with Crowley Fu e ls L LC for furnishing and delivering diesel fuel to various locations in the City. Section 2. That this resolution takes effect immediately upon adoption. The City received the following Bids: Bidder Price per gallon Crowley Fuels LLC $2.705 Alaska Oil Sales Inc $3.084 The scope of this agreement includes furnishing and delivering Ultra Low Sulfur Non-Highway Diesel No. 1 Fuel to City emergency generators and the Airport Operations Fuel Tank. The successful Bidder must subscribe to the Oil Price Information Service (OPIS). The OPIS report submitted with the bid and used as a base price for future $/gallon adjustment was $2.785/gallon. The OPIS Unbranded Rack Average is utilized to account for fluctuations within the market throughout the duration of the Contract. As example the percentage savings we have today $2.705/$2.785 = 97% of market average, will remain the same percentage for the duration of contract, regardless of whether the market rate goes up or down. Crowley Fuels LLC, is the lowest responsive and responsible Bidder. The term of the agreement will be from July 1, 2018 through June 30, 2021. The agreement term may be extended upon mutual agreement of both parties for two additional one year periods. The agreement may not extend beyond June 30, 2023. It should be noted the last time this Contract was awarded in 2013, the price was $3.762/gallon.
